The Baltimore Ravens are internet hosting the primary convention championship sport in Baltimore since 1971 after Lamar Jackson accounted for 4 touchdowns — two throwing and two dashing — in a 34-10 victory over the Houston Texans Saturday.

The sport was tied at 10 at one level, however Baltimore received with 24 unanswered factors.

After incomes a playoff bye, feelings ran excessive in Baltimore’s locker room, and it was Jackson’s second playoff win.

Ravens head coach John Harbaugh opened his postgame press convention by studying a Bible verse.

“Greatness, energy, glory, victory and honor belong to you, as a result of every little thing in heaven and on earth belongs to you. The dominion belongs to you, Lord,” Harbaugh mentioned, through OutKick NFL insider Armando Salguero, reciting 1 Chronicles.

Harbaugh’s quote got here every week after C.J. Stroud, the quarterback Harbaugh’s Ravens beat Saturday, gave “all glory to my Lord and savior Jesus Christ” after the Texans’ playoff win over the Cleveland Browns.

Stroud’s feedback have been edited out of a submit on X, previously Twitter, from the official account of NBC’s “Sunday Night time Soccer.”

Former Philadelphia Eagles quarterback Donovan McNabb, Salguero’s cohost on Outkick’s podcast, “The 5,” criticized NBC for the transfer.

“It’s very lame. Gamers at all times categorical that as effectively, and to have that reduce out is really … it’s disrespectful,” he mentioned. “There are lots of people on the market who’re Christians and imagine in Jesus, and those that don’t imagine in Jesus, nonetheless, they don’t really feel like that’s disrespectful to them.

“For NBC to do that … they actually have to return … and consider themselves. They need to get this factor corrected as a result of that’s positively not the course it must be getting in at this level.”

Harbaugh quoted Bible scripture a day after his brother, Michigan head coach Jim Harbaugh, spoke on the March for Life in Washington, D.C. Jim additionally attended the Ravens’ sport Saturday.

The Ravens subsequent host the winner of Sunday’s Payments-Chiefs sport.
